North Haven, Connecticut, is a quiet suburb located just outside the bustling city of New Haven. Known for its spacious homes on large lots, North Haven features a mix of cottages, split-levels, and Colonial Revivals, with most homes built in the mid-to-late 20th century. The town has maintained a steady population growth, now home to just over 24,000 residents. North Haven is safer than the national average, with a lower crime risk. The North Haven School District is highly rated, with North Haven Middle School and North Haven High School both receiving favorable reviews. Additionally, the prestigious Choate Rosemary Hall, located in nearby Wallingford, is considered the best private school in the state.
Peter's Rock Park offers scenic hiking trails and panoramic views of New Haven and surrounding mountains, while the Walter Gawrych Community Pool provides year-round indoor swimming. The town green, bordered by historic buildings, hosts various community events, including a summer concert series and seasonal celebrations. North Haven's Parks and Recreation department offers over 150 programs annually, catering to all age groups.
Commercial development is centered around State Street and Washington Avenue, with the Amazon fulfillment center being a major employer. Future developments are expected to bring more businesses to the area. For shopping, residents frequent Target, BJ’s Wholesale Club, and Washington Commons. Commuters have convenient access to Interstate 91, with Hartford 30 miles north and New Haven 8 miles south. Public transportation options include CTtransit buses and the New Haven line into New York City. Tweed New Haven Airport is 10 miles south of North Haven.
On average, homes in North Haven, CT sell after 48 days on the market compared to the national average of 53 days. The median sale price for homes in North Haven, CT over the last 12 months is $453,500, up 4% from the median home sale price over the previous 12 months.
